linux安装mysql,更改密码的时候发生了以下报错,大致意思就是修改之前要有一个复杂度高的密码:
You must reset your password using ALTER USER statement before executing this statement.
解决方法:
1.先设置这个密码,一会改
ALTER USER USER() IDENTIFIED BY '@Qqq1111111';
2.输出一个表格可以看到当前密码策略为MEDIUM
SHOW VARIABLES LIKE 'validate_password%';
3.设置为低级
set global validate_password.policy=LOW;
4.设置密码最低长度 随便 不设置也行
set global validate_password_length=5;
5.再次设置你想要的密码
ALTER USER USER() IDENTIFIED BY '12345';
完事喽,有不懂的私信我,看见回